我在iis中为503错误创建了一个错误页面。现在我停止我的网站应用程序池。我得到的其他页面服务不可用而不是我的自定义错误页面。我也尝试在web.config中配置。它不起作用请帮帮我..
试过1
<httpErrors errorMode="Custom">
<remove statusCode="503" subStatusCode="-1" />
<error statusCode="503" prefixLanguageFilePath="" path="/503.htm"
responseMode="ExecuteURL" />
</httpErrors>
尝试了2
<customErrors mode="On">
<error statusCode="503" redirect="~/503.htm"/>
</customErrors>
答案 0 :(得分:2)
如果站点停止,则表示没有实例正在侦听对此站点的请求。因此,web.config无法做到这一点。
如果您的意思是使用自定义页面进行网站维护,则可以使用app_offline.htm文件:
使用消息使ASP.NET站点脱机 http://weblogs.asp.net/pleloup/archive/2008/09/22/taking-an-asp-net-site-offline-with-a-message.aspx